Clay tiles boast a rich history that dates back thousands of years. Used in ancient civilizations for both structural and decorative purposes, these tiles have evolved significantly over time. The term nib typically refers to the unique edge profile of the tile, which allows for easy interlocking and installation. Historically, nib tiles were crafted by skilled artisans who employed traditional methods, leading to beautiful variations in color, texture, and pattern. This artisanal quality is what makes clay nib tiles particularly appealing today, as there is a growing appreciation for handcrafted items in an increasingly industrialized world.

- If an old roof is in place, it typically must be removed before the new shingles can be installed. The cost of removal can add $1 to $5 per square foot to the project, depending on the complexity of the job (such as the number of layers to be removed) and disposal costs. Therefore, homeowners should factor in these expenses when budgeting for a roof replacement.

When it comes to roofing, one of the most critical factors influencing the project is the cost per square to shingle a roof. This term refers to the price applied to each “square” of roofing material, with one square covering an area of 100 square feet. Understanding this cost is vital for homeowners considering a roof replacement or installation, as it allows for better budgeting and decision-making.

- Labor costs can vary based on the region and the contractor's expertise. In general, labor can account for 60% of the total cost of replacing a roof. It's crucial to get multiple quotes from contractors and to consider their experience and references, as quality workmanship can prevent future issues.

cost of asphalt shingle roof per squareDespite their many advantages, it is essential to consider the installation process when opting for ceramic flat roof tiles. While they are relatively easy to handle, professional installation is recommended to ensure proper alignment and sealing. Additionally, the weight of ceramic tiles can necessitate reinforcement of the underlying structure, particularly in older buildings.

Firstly, it's important to understand the term square in roofing. A square is a unit of measure that covers an area of 100 square feet. Therefore, when discussing the cost of asphalt shingles, roofing contractors and suppliers typically use this unit as a standard metric for pricing.

On top of the decking, a layer of underlayment is installed. This is critical for enhancing the roof’s waterproofing capabilities. Underlayment typically consists of felt paper or synthetic materials that provide an additional barrier against moisture infiltration. It also protects the decking from potential leaks caused by ice damming or heavy rains. When selecting underlayment, homeowners can choose from different types, such as asphalt-saturated felt or a newer synthetic underlayment that offers heightened durability and water resistance.
